Dear Residents, Following the recent spike in burglaries, your local Community Policing officer have been working tirelessly to keep EDGWARE Ward safe. Officers have been doing reassurance visits, street briefings and crime-prevention sessions, reminding residents to stay vigilant and report anything suspicious.
In the early hours of 22nd November at 00:20 hours, officers responded to a call on CAMROSE AVENUE after a resident reported someone inside their neighbour's house. When responding officers arrived, they caught a male suspect on the spot, dressed in black clothing with a white hood, balaclava and gloves. He was arrested at the scene and investigation is ongoing. Thank you to the resident who called . it really helped. Please stay vigilant, and if you see or hear anything suspicious, call 999 in an emergency or 101 for non-emergencies.
Team will continue to patrol and organise Community Crime Fighting Sessions in the ward.
